Lockheed Martin taps Silicon Photonics Tech to Build Better Weapons of War

Oct 19, 2022Media

Military contractor Lockheed Martin this week announced plans to integrate Ayar Lab’s optical input tech into future defense platforms.

Founded in 2015, the California-based Ayar Labs specializes in developing high-bandwidth interfaces which trade copper traces for low-bandwidth optical transmission. Lockheed Martin’s relationship with the silicon photonics startup dates back to early 2020, when the military contractor announced a “strategic investment” in the firm to further the development of what is now the company’s TeraPHY chiplet.
